Xiaomi celebrates its 15 years with great fanfare by offering superb offers

To celebrate its 15th anniversary as it should, Xiaomi therefore gives you the benefit of attractive discounts on many products From April 4 to 20.

The brand makes you save 100 euros in particular on its latest Redmi Note 14 Pro 5G. Released just a few months ago, the smartphone thus increases to 303 euros instead of 403 euros in its 256 GB/8 GB version. Among the other flagship offers, the Xiaomi 14T benefits from up to 150 euros of discount, and the bundle which includes the Redmi Pad Pro tablet and a keyboard benefits from 80 euros of immediate reduction.

Many other products are in the spotlight such as the Redmi Note 14 which sees its Price drop by 50 euros or even the Poco X7 Pro which benefits from up to 80 euros in discount.

Crazy offers on smartphones

The Redmi Note 14 PRO 5G is a mid -range smartphone that displays premium ambitions. It actually has a particularly solid technical sheet in view of its price positioning, even more with the discount which it is subject to during the event-which allows it to immediately rise to the best value-price models in its category.

The model has a SOC Mediatek Dimensity 7300 Ultra and 8 GB or 12 GB of RAM depending on the version. A configuration that allows it to manage the multitasking without flinching, and to offer fluid navigation in all daily uses. The mobile is also doing very well in the gaming exercise.

The Redmi Note 14 PRO 5G also offers a very good display experience with its 6.67 -inch slab to the definition 1,220 X 2,712 pixels, to the adaptive refresh rate of up to 120 Hz, and to the high brightness, with a peak measured with more than 1250 nits.

The smartphone is compatible with 5G, Wi-Fi 6 and Bluetooth 5.4 technologies. It also comes with an IP68 certification, which guarantees its waterproofing to water and dust. On the autonomy side, its 5110 mAh battery, compatible with the 45 W fast load, can offer up to a day of use. This model also counts on a triple rear photo sensor, including a main module of 200 Mpx.

The Redmi Note 14 PRO 5G benefits from a discount of 100 euros for Xiaomi’s birthday. The 256 GB/8 GB model therefore increases to 303 euros instead of 403 euros.

The Xiaomi 14T, another flagship smartphone from the brand in the middle of the range, also benefits from a nice discount, up to 150 euros. This phone, available in a single version of 256 GB and 12 GB of RAM, benefits as the previous model of a very interesting technical sheet.

The model initially offers high -flying performance which allow it to execute all the applications of the Play Store without the slightest slowdown, and also to run all the games without latency. It is based to do this on a Mediatek Dimensity 9300+ SOC.

For the display, Xiaomi opted for an AMOLED 6.67 -inch AMOLED screen, compatible Dolby Vision and HDR10+, at the adaptive refresh rate of 144 Hz, with the resolution of 1,220 x 2,712 pixels, and with high brightness, with a peak measured at almost 1,300 nits.

The smartphone, certified IP68, also counts on excellent autonomy with its 5000 mAh battery, compatible with rapid recharging at 67 W. It is also equipped with a triple rear photo sensor of 50, 50 and 12 Mpx. Originally sold at 653 euros, the Xiaomi 14T thus increases to 503 euros with the applied discount.

Xiaomi also offers a nice offer on its Redmi Pad Pro tablet, accompanied by its keyboard. This model, equipped with a Snapdragon 7S Gen 2 SOC, supported by 6 or 8 GB of RAM, delivers very good performance. This results in a fluid navigation experience in all uses and in multitasking.

This tablet also offers a good -made display experience with its comfortable 12.1 inch LCD screen, which has a definition of 1,600 x 2,560 pixels, as well as an adaptive cooling rate between 60 and 120 Hz and brightness of more than 600 nits, a very satisfactory score for a tablet.

On the autonomy side, this tablet has a 10,000 mAh battery, compatible with the fast load at 33 W, which allows it to offer a good day of use.

At the back as at the front, there is an 8 Mpx camera. In both cases, the tablet performs a correct photographic service and can film up to 1080p at 30 frames per second. With the presentation of the moment, it therefore increases to 251 euros instead of 331 euros in its 128/6 GB version.
